Rheumatic heart disease was the predisposing cardiac lesion for IE in 20 to 25 per cent. In patients with rheumatic heart disease, endocarditis occurs most frequently on the mitral valve, a site at which women are more commonly infected. The aortic valve is the next most common site for IE; infection in this setting occurs more commonly in men.
Congenital heart disease is the substrate for IE in 10 to 20 per cent of younger adults and 8 per cent of older adults. Among adults, the common predisposing lesions are patent ductus arteriosus, ventricular septal defect, and bicuspid aortic value, the latter particularly found among older men (> 60 years).
